How they compare
Saudi Arabia currently reports 1,006 against 882.53 in Papua New Guinea, a difference of 123.47.
That makes Saudi Arabia's figure about 1.1 times Papua New Guinea's.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 43 shared years of data; in 1961 it was Saudi Arabia ahead.
Papua New Guinea ranks 113th and Saudi Arabia ranks 110th of 143 countries.
Across the 6 decades both report, Papua New Guinea averaged higher in 5 and Saudi Arabia in 1.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Papua New Guinea | Saudi Arabia |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1960s | 1,563 | 2,874 | 1,312 | Saudi Arabia |
| 1970s | 1,438 | 673.1 | 765.1 | Papua New Guinea |
| 1980s | 553.1 | 8.8 | 544.3 | Papua New Guinea |
| 1990s | 634.29 | 0 | 634.29 | Papua New Guinea |
| 2010s | 860.16 | 209 | 651.16 | Papua New Guinea |
| 2020s | 875.29 | 865.95 | 9.34 | Papua New Guinea |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
